Real-World Testing: Putting Roman Carbide Fingernail 1/2 Shank to the Test
First Use Experience
My testing ground for these bits was my home workshop, specifically on a piece of cherry wood destined for a custom jewelry box. I mounted the Roman Carbide Fingernail bit into my plunge router, ensuring the 1/2-inch shank was seated securely. Setting up involved a few test passes on scrap lumber to dial in the exact depth and speed, a standard procedure for any new profiling bit.
The initial cuts were remarkably smooth, even on the relatively soft cherry. The bit produced a clean, gentle radius that was precisely what I’d hoped for. I ran it through several passes, varying the speed slightly to observe any differences in chip-out or heat buildup; thankfully, none were significant.
There were no immediate surprises or quirks. The bit performed exactly as its design suggested, creating a pleasant, rounded edge without the harshness sometimes associated with bullnose profiles. The consistency of the cut across multiple passes was a significant advantage.

Breaking Down the Features of Roman Carbide Fingernail 1/2 Shank
Specifications
The Roman Carbide Fingernail 1/2 Shank bit is characterized by its core construction and intended application. It features a carbide cutting edge that is renowned for its hardness and durability, ensuring a long lifespan and consistent performance. The bit is designed with a specific profile that creates a larger radius than a standard bullnose bit, resulting in a more gentle, flowing rounded effect. This particular model utilizes a 1/2-inch shank, which is the standard size for most professional and high-end routers, providing a secure and stable fit.
These specifications translate directly into practical benefits for the user. The carbide material means the bit will remain sharp through many projects, reducing the frequency of replacement and ensuring precise cuts over time. The larger, gentler radius is crucial for decorative work where a subtle softening of edges is desired, preventing sharp corners without creating an overly bulbous profile. The 1/2-inch shank offers superior rigidity and control compared to smaller shank diameters, which is especially important when routing at higher speeds or in harder woods.

Durability & Maintenance
Given the nature of carbide tooling, the Roman Carbide Fingernail 1/2 Shank is built for longevity. Under normal woodworking conditions, such as those I’ve subjected it to, this bit is designed to last for years, if not decades, before requiring any attention. The inherent hardness of tungsten carbide means it resists abrasion and wear far better than high-speed steel bits.
Maintenance is blessedly simple; a light cleaning after each use to remove sawdust and resin buildup is sufficient. I haven’t experienced any issues like chipping or premature dulling, so there haven’t been any specific maintenance challenges. For deeper cleaning or if resin buildup becomes stubborn, a good quality router bit cleaner or a soak in a suitable solvent would be the next step, but this is rarely necessary with carbide.
